Abstract
A wireless access control system is provided to lock or unlock a first door at a dwelling of a user. A user remote access device accepts input based on haptic feedback or motion. The user remote access device is configured to be in communication with an intelligent door lock system at a dwelling with a door and associated lock. The intelligent door lock system includes: a position sensing device coupled to a drive shaft, with the position sensing device sensing position of the drive shaft and configured to assist in locking and unlocking the lock, an engine with a memory coupled to the positioning sensing device and the drive shaft, and an energy source configured to provide electrical energy. When the user remote access device is at an exterior of the dwelling, and in a close proximity to the dwelling, in response to the user remote access device accepting input based on haptic feedback or motion, the bolt is caused to move and the first lock is locked or unlocked. The user remote access device is configured to be in communication with a second lock at a vehicle of the user or at an office of the user.
